  11. So here's the skinny on the jeep I got it over a year ago from a buddy of mine for $650! He had gotten side swipped by a chick with no insurance and being to nice he let her go so its not the straightest body but it will work for my plans:) so when my friend got it it was running like it had a giant cam in it we pulled the head off to find out that the person before him that rebuilt the motor had over heated it and cracked a piston. The jeep runs fantastic off idle though with a slight blue.cloud of smoke behind it. But still has more power then any of the jeeps I've been in(all 91+) so enough with the background. I picked up a motor out of a friend's jeep that fought fire...which used to be mine. The motor had 160k on it when I pulled it out of the 96 Cherokee the fire department decided to stick their hose down the intake for what ever reason and fill it up with water. So I rebuilt the motor bored it .040 over and I'm sticking a comp cam 232-4 In it. Still waiting on my keepers for it to throw it together. Anyways back to the manche. It's a 91 long bed 4wd 5speed 4.0 my intention was to chop the whole rear frame off and truggy it but my pockets aren't deep enough for that right now.so what I'm doing is moving the axle forward around 12-13 inches then chopping the bed down and throwing it back together so far what I have done is the bed is off the perches are off and I moved the front spring perches where I want them and welded them up I'm waiting tell next week to set the shackle angle and burn the hangers on I will be updating this as much as possible
